Output d58013cc6973251d6239ec20dbf17c28db7353e11f7c5009bd56fade1340323d:112
- value
- 146543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d3b92cf595d47034be1523abd83cb20f2e80e9 OP_EQUAL
- address
- 3DtdRrRUHExathFaqg99N1Ka6apshqCWi6
- transaction
- d58013cc6973251d6239ec20dbf17c28db7353e11f7c5009bd56fade1340323d
- confirmations
- 194793
- spent
- true